Multivalued Linear Operators and Differential Inclusions in Banach Spaces
In this paper, we study multivalued linear operators (MLO’s) and their resolvents in non reflexive Banach spaces, introducing a new condition of a minimal growth at infinity, more general than the HilleYosida condition. متن کاملModern Computational Applications of Dynamic Programming
Computational dynamic programming, while of some use for situations typically encountered in industrial and systems engineering, has proved to be of much greater significance in many areas of computer science. We review some of these applications here.
متن کاملNonlinear Alternatives for Multivalued Maps with Applications to Operator Inclusions in Abstract Spaces
A nonlinear alternative of Leray–Schauder type is presented for condensing operators with closed graph. We will then use this theorem to establish new existence principles for differential and integral inclusions in Banach spaces.
